Vehicle Dimensions
The dimensions of these vehicles differ considerably. The Ford Kuga 2.0 TDCi Start/Stopp is  6.3 inches longer,  2.4 inches narrower and  2.6 inches taller than the Land Rover Range Rover Evoque 2.2 Td4.
